Our 7-month-old puppy spends a little time here and a little time there, lays down, moves, gets up, lays back down, comes to smell my feet, gets pet, goes and lays down, moves, lays down again. Is this normal? I'm usually on the couch that has carpet underneath it. He tends to go and plop down where there is just flooring. I'm guessing it's cooler there. I see bulldogs sleeping on beds, blankets, and in laps all the time so I can't imagine he's sooooo hot he can't stand it. He's not panting during any of this. It just seems like he can't' find the perfect spot to lay down. I'd describe it all as restless.

What are your thoughts/experiences? Is there anything I can do to make him more comfortable?
